Python引用文件的核心是通过import语句使当前脚本访问其他模块的变量、函数或类,关键在于Python解释器如何通过sys.path查找模块,并正确组织__init__.py以支持包导入和相对导入。

Python 引用文件,核心是“让当前脚本能访问并使用另一个 Python 文件里的变量、函数或类”,这主要通过 import 语句实现。关键不在于“路径怎么写”,而在于Python 解释器如何找到那个文件(即模块搜索路径)。下面分几种常见情况说明:
如果 a.py 和 b.py 在同一个文件夹里,想在 a.py 中用 b.py 里的函数:
如果 b.py 在子文件夹 utils/b.py,且该文件夹里有 __init__.py(可以为空),就构成了一个包:
如果目标文件在任意位置(比如桌面、D:\mylib),Python 默认找不到,可以临时加路径:
立即学习“Python免费学习笔记(深入)”;
在包结构中,比如 pkg/a.py 想导入同级的 pkg/b.py:
基本上就这些。关键是理解 import 不是“读文本”,而是“加载模块对象”;路径问题本质是管理 sys.path 和组织好 __init__.py。不复杂但容易忽略细节。
以上就是python怎么引用文件的详细内容,更多请关注php中文网其它相关文章!
python怎么学习?python怎么入门?python在哪学?python怎么学才快?不用担心,这里为大家提供了python速学教程(入门到精通),有需要的小伙伴保存下载就能学习啦!
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号